Essential Maintenance Tips for Your Aluminium Windows and Doors

Aluminium windows and doors are prized for their durability, sleek appearance, and low maintenance requirements. Here are some essential maintenance tips to keep your aluminium windows and doors looking and functioning their best:

Regular Cleaning

Regular cleaning is key to maintaining the aesthetic appeal of your aluminium windows and doors. Use a mild detergent or soap solution and a soft cloth or sponge to gently clean the frames and glass surfaces. Avoid abrasive cleaners or materials that could scratch the aluminium or damage the finish. Pay attention to corners and crevices where dirt and debris may accumulate.

Inspect and Clear Drainage Holes

Aluminium windows and doors often have drainage holes designed to prevent water buildup. Periodically inspect these holes to ensure they are clear of debris such as dirt, leaves, or insects. Use a soft brush or compressed air to clean out any obstructions, allowing proper drainage and preventing potential water damage.

Lubricate Moving Parts

To maintain smooth operation, lubricate the moving parts of your aluminium windows and doors regularly. Apply a silicone-based lubricant to hinges, handles, and locks to prevent friction and ensure effortless opening and closing. Wipe away any excess lubricant to avoid attracting dirt and dust.

Check Weather Stripping

Weather stripping helps seal gaps and improve energy efficiency. Inspect the weather stripping around your aluminium windows and doors periodically for signs of wear or damage. Replace any worn-out weather stripping to maintain optimal insulation and prevent drafts.

Monitor Glass Condition

Regularly inspect the condition of the glass in your windows and doors. Look for cracks, chips, or fogging between panes, which may indicate a broken seal. Promptly address any issues with the glass to maintain both the aesthetic appeal and the thermal efficiency of your aluminium fixtures.

Protect Against Harsh Elements

Aluminium is naturally resistant to corrosion, but exposure to harsh elements over time can still affect its appearance. If your home or business is located in a coastal or industrial area, consider applying a protective coating to the aluminium surfaces. This additional layer of protection can help maintain the finish and prolong the life of your windows and doors.
